C171TIBLP - Mike Draper Folder - Titanium
Mike Draper is a Wyoming native who grew up carrying and using knives. When his wife Audra developed an interest in making custom knives in the mid 1990s, he naturally followed suit and soon began crafting handmade blades part time. In 2000, a back injury ended his career as a heavy equipment mechanic, so he began making knives full time. Since then, he has earned a Journeyman Smith rating from the American Bladesmith Society and developed a distinctive style of knifemaking that includes everything from tough tactical folders to investment-quality art knives. This unique approach has not only earned him a loyal following among his customers, but also piqued Spyderco’s curiosity, ultimately leading to his first design collaboration.
Spyderco’s Mike Draper Folder reflects both extremes of Draper’s talents as a knifemaker, combining a practical, highly functional folding knife pattern with exceptional craftsmanship and a sophisticated colorized handle treatment. The business end of the knife is a modified drop-point blade made from VG-10 stainless steel. Its full-flat grind balances strength and low-friction edge geometry and ensures an acute but resilient point. An easily accessible Trademark Round Hole proudly proclaims it as a Spyderco product and allows swift one-handed opening with either hand.
By far the most distinctive feature of the Mike Draper Folder is its handle, which is assembled from precision-machined solid titanium components. The two scales are intricately CNC machined to produce a stunning spider web pattern and areas with a subtle surface texture. Portions of the pattern are then colorized to contrast boldly against the matte-finished titanium and further highlight the design.
The handle’s profile flares at both ends to create a highly functional integral guard and a butt hook. This shape effectively brackets the hand between the two ends and, together with the subtle texture of the scale designs, provides an amazingly solid, comfortable grip. The handle also houses a solid, full-length back spacer and a sturdy Walker Linerlock mechanism, both of which are finished flush with the scales to maintain the knife’s graceful lines and prevent unintentional release of the lock during use. Purpose designed for right-side, tip-up carry, the Mike Draper Folder features a custom pocket clip that flows seamlessly with the handle contours and the colorized spider web pattern. .
A dramatic departure from the Spyderco norm, the Mike Draper Folder is a both a work of art and a practical everyday cutting tool that truly reflects the style and versatility of its designer.
